What affects the price

The final bill for septic work depends on a few specific variables. First, the size of your tank and the total volume of waste removal play a role. We also look at the accessibility of your tank lids; if they are buried deep underground or hidden under landscaping, extra labor is required to reach them. The distance from our truck to the tank also impacts the setup time. Every property has unique plumbing needs, and ex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

About this service

Pumping services are essential for removing the layer of solids that accumulates in your tank over time. You typically need this service every few years to prevent sludge from overflowing into your drain field, which could lead to a system failure. What are the signs that my Dallas septic tank needs cleaning?

Signs that your Dallas septic tank needs cleaning include slow drains in sinks and toilets, sewage odors around your property, or gurgling sounds from your plumbing. You might also notice unusually lush or wet spots in your yard over the drain field. Ignoring these signals can lead to serious backups and damage. Early detection is key to preventing major issues. What's the purpose of a septic distribution box, and how is it checked?

A septic distribution box in Dallas is crucial for evenly distributing wastewater from the septic tank to the drain field. It ensures effluent reaches all parts of the field, preventing overloading in one area. During an inspection, professionals check if the box is level and if the pipes are functioning correctly.
